Handover Note — Signed Contracts, Brindlemoor to Aster Point

To whoever's on at Aster Point: the signed Wrenfold contracts leave Brindlemoor with the afternoon courier run. There are three folders, each in a sealed envelope, sealed by me this morning. Count them on arrival and initial the inner log — legal wants a clean chain of custody on these. Keep them in the fireproof cabinet until Dalia collects them. When the courier presents the envelopes, apply the standing check.

handover note for tadug-yaguf: the aldath pelwyn courier leaves the casox norwyn briix silok zorok kasdor aldion quenox ledger at gate 2653 under passcode 959015

Subject: Quickstore 4.2 — bloom filter now fronts the KV layer

Plugin authors: starting with this release, Quickstore places a bloom filter ahead of the key-value store. Negative lookups return faster; false positives fall through safely. No API changes are required on your side. Verify your plugin against the staging build referenced below.

session token of fahif-tadup = htk3_9c7

Handover notes. SQL lint rules moved to the shared Brindlecore config last sprint. Run the linter before merging; CI blocks on violations of keyword casing and missing semicolons. Custom rules live in the migrations folder, don't edit inline. Two flaky rules are suppressed pending a fix upstream. New folks: questions about rule exceptions go to the data platform rotation.

alerts address for kajog-tadup: druox@plorvanet.internal

Subject: DR drill follow-up — tax-rate cache

Team: drill on Fenwick Ledger's tax-rate lookup cache completed. Cache rebuild from cold snapshot took 11 minutes; acceptable. Rehydration script now lives in the ops repo. If the cache node must be restored manually, the recovery vault requires the passphrase noted below.

recovery phrase for bawef-kagug: casix-tamvan-lamath-holeth-gilmir-drudor-julax-wenok-wenael-rusvan-holax-goriel-frawyn